Lire la suiteInducteur de puissance SMD miniature, petite taille et faible profil, sur un noyau ferrite spécial. Faible résistance DC, haute capacité de courant, caractéristiques d'impédance élevées, ils sont excellents pour être utilisés comme une bobine d'étouffement dans les circuits d'alimentation DC.

- Test equipment:
• L & Q: HP4285A Precision LCR meter
• DCR: Milli-ohm meter
- Electrical specifications at 25°C
for 252010E / 252012E / 252510 / 322515C
- Rated DC Current(I sat): The current when the inductance becomes 30% typical its initial value (Ta=25°C)
- Temperature Rise Current(I rms): The actual current when the temperature of coil becomes ΔT40°C. (Ta=25°C)
- Operating temperature range: -40 ~ 125°C
except 252010E / 252012E / 252510 / 322515C
- Rated DC Current: The current when the inductance becomes 10% lower than its initial value or the current when the temperature of coil increases ΔT20°C. The smaller one is defined as Rated DC Current. (Ta=25°C)
- Operating temperature range: -40 ~ 125°C
